About Gajpura Village

Gajpura is a mid sized village in Bari tehsil, in the district of Dhaulpur, Rajasthan.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 731, made up of 402 males and 329 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 818 females per 1000 males. The village covers 962.68 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 328021,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.

Getting to Gajpura

The census records public bus service for Gajpura as Available within 5 - 10 km distance. Private bus service is recorded as Available within village. For rail, the census notes the nearest railway station as Available within 10+ km distance. These entries describe what was recorded in 2011 and services may have changed since.
